Bhana Village Population, Sex Ratio & Literacy Rate
Bhana is a village in Adampur tehsil, Hisar district, Haryana, India. As per Census 2011, the total population is 4094, sex ratio is 91.21905651564688 females per 1,000 males, and the overall literacy rate is 58.35%. The PIN code of Bhana is 125048.
